Filtros y Busqueda de Logs
Encuentra rapidamente las ejecuciones que necesitas con filtros avanzados y opciones de busqueda.
Filtros Disponibles
Barra de Filtros
Filtros: [Agente] [Estado] [Resultado] [Periodo] [Buscar candidato...] [Limpiar]
Filtrar por Agente
Selector de Agente
[Todos los agentes]
- Pre-Screening Automatico
- Recordatorio de Documentos
- Bot de Screening
- Workflow de Onboarding
- Match Score Calculator
Comportamiento
Seleccion:
- Un agente: Muestra solo ese agente
- Todos: Muestra todos los agentes
- Se aplica inmediatamente
Filtrar por Estado
Estados Disponibles
[Todos los estados]
- Pendiente (pending)
- Ejecutando (running)
- Esperando (waiting)
- Completado (completed)
- Fallido (failed)
- Cancelado (cancelled)
Combinaciones Utiles
Estados activos:
- pending + running + waiting
Estados terminales:
- completed + failed + cancelled
Con problemas:
- failed (solo errores)
Filtrar por Resultado
Tipos de Resultado
[Todos los resultados]
- Exito (success)
- Fallo (failure)
- Timeout (timeout)
- Cancelado (cancelled)
- Escalado (escalated)
Diferencia Estado vs Resultado
| Concepto | Descripcion | Ejemplos |
|---|---|---|
| Estado | Fase de ejecucion. Esta corriendo? Termino? | completed, running, failed |
| Resultado | Outcome final. Fue exitoso? Que paso? | success, failure, escalated |
Ejemplo:
Estado: completed + Resultado: escalated = Ejecucion termino, pero fue transferida a humano
Filtrar por Periodo
Periodos Predefinidos
[Periodo]
- Hoy
- Ayer
- Ultimos 7 dias
- Ultimos 14 dias
- Ultimos 30 dias
- Este mes
- Personalizado...
Rango Personalizado
Rango de Fechas
| Campo | Valor |
|---|---|
| Desde | [15/01/2024] [00:00] |
| Hasta | [20/01/2024] [23:59] |
[Cancelar] [Aplicar]
Busqueda de Candidatos
Campo de Busqueda
[Buscar candidato...]
- Busca por nombre
- Busca por email
- Busca por telefono
Comportamiento
Busqueda:
- Minimo 2 caracteres
- Busqueda parcial (contiene)
- No distingue mayusculas/minusculas
- Debounce de 300ms
Ejemplos
| Busqueda | Resultado |
|---|---|
| "juan" | Juan Perez, Juana Lopez |
| "@gmail" | Todos con email de Gmail |
| "55 1234" | Telefonos que contienen |
| "perez" | Apellido Perez |
Combinacion de Filtros
Logica AND
Todos los filtros se combinan con AND:
Agente: "Pre-Screening"
- Estado: "failed"
- Periodo: "Ultimos 7 dias"
- Busqueda: "juan"
= Ejecuciones fallidas del Pre-Screening en los ultimos 7 dias para candidatos que contienen "juan"
Indicador de Filtros Activos
Filtros activos: 3 [x]
- Agente: Pre-Screening
- Estado: failed
- Periodo: Ultimos 7 dias
Ordenamiento
Columnas Ordenables
Click en encabezado para ordenar:
| Columna | Ordena por |
|---|---|
| AGENTE | Nombre de agente |
| CANDIDATO | Nombre de candidato |
| ESTADO | Estado |
| FECHA | Fecha de creacion (default) |
| DURACION | Tiempo de ejecucion |
| CREDITOS | Creditos IA usados |
Orden Ascendente/Descendente
| Click | Resultado |
|---|---|
| Click 1 | Ascendente (A-Z, antiguo-nuevo) |
| Click 2 | Descendente (Z-A, nuevo-antiguo) |
| Click 3 | Sin orden (default) |
Orden por Defecto
Default: Fecha descendente
- Ejecuciones mas recientes primero
Paginacion
Controles
Mostrando 1-20 de 234 resultados
[< Primera] [< Anterior] Pagina [3] de 12 [Siguiente >] [Ultima >]
Configuracion
| Parametro | Valor |
|---|---|
| Items por pagina | 20 (fijo) |
Nota: La paginacion se reinicia al cambiar cualquier filtro.
Limpiar Filtros
Boton Limpiar
[Limpiar Filtros]
- Resetea todos los filtros
- Vuelve a valores default
- Mantiene ordenamiento
- Regresa a pagina 1
Limpiar Individual
[Agente: Pre-Screening x]
- Click en x para quitar filtro individual
Exportar Datos
Boton Exportar
[Exportar]
- CSV
- Excel
- JSON
Contenido del Export
El export incluye:
- ID de ejecucion
- Nombre del agente
- Tipo de evento
- Candidato (nombre, email)
- Estado
- Resultado
- Duracion (segundos)
- Creditos IA
- Fecha inicio
- Fecha fin
- Error (si aplica)
- Resumen
Nota: Exporta datos filtrados, no todas las ejecuciones.
Formato CSV
id,agent_name,event_type,candidate_name,candidate_email,status,result,duration_seconds,ai_credits,started_at,completed_at,error_message
12345,Pre-Screening,APPLICATION_CREATED,Juan Perez,juan@email.com,completed,success,2.3,7,2024-01-20 14:32:15,2024-01-20 14:32:17,
12346,Recordatorio,SCHEDULED,Maria Lopez,maria@email.com,failed,failure,0.5,0,2024-01-20 14:15:00,,Rate limit exceeded
Guardar Filtros
Vista Guardada (Futuro)
Proximamente:
- Guardar combinacion de filtros
- Nombrar vista personalizada
- Acceso rapido desde menu
- Compartir con equipo
Atajos de Teclado
| Atajo | Accion |
|---|---|
| Ctrl/Cmd + F | Enfocar busqueda |
| Escape | Limpiar busqueda |
| Enter | Aplicar busqueda |
| R | Actualizar lista |
Rendimiento
Optimizaciones
La busqueda esta optimizada:
- Indices en BD para filtros comunes
- Paginacion del lado del servidor
- Cache de contadores
- Debounce en busqueda de texto
- Lazy loading de detalles
Limites
| Limite | Valor |
|---|---|
| Maximo de resultados | 10,000 |
| Rango de fechas maximo | 90 dias |
- Si hay mas de 10,000 resultados, refinar filtros
- Export limitado a resultados filtrados
- Para rangos mayores a 90 dias, usar Analytics
Casos de Uso Comunes
Encontrar Errores Recientes
| Filtro | Valor |
|---|---|
| Estado | failed |
| Periodo | Hoy |
| Ordenar por | Fecha DESC |
Ver Actividad de un Candidato
| Filtro | Valor |
|---|---|
| Busqueda | "juan@email.com" |
| Periodo | Ultimos 30 dias |
Auditar Agente Especifico
| Filtro | Valor |
|---|---|
| Agente | "Pre-Screening" |
| Periodo | Este mes |
| Accion | Exportar: CSV |
Monitorear Ejecuciones Activas
| Filtro | Valor |
|---|---|
| Estado | running + waiting |
| Ordenar por | Fecha DESC |
Proximos Pasos
- Analytics - Metricas agregadas
- Dashboard - Visualizaciones
- Detalle de Ejecucion - Ver ejecucion especifica